GEORGIA 24 HOURS

As one of BBC Music's Sound of 2020 longlisters, Georgia has made a considerable impact the year since her distinctive rhythm-first style took on a more synth and pop acumen. That being said, we’ve been fans of Georgia for years now, covering her riotous ‘Feel It’ back in 2017 and her dystopian Bjork-esque ‘Nothing Solutions’ in 2015. We’ve even had the pleasure to interview this session drummer turned one-person band. Okay, that’s enough lamenting on the past for now, let’s talk about the brand new ‘24 Hours’. Opening with a suggestive heartbeat, electronic keys and the spoken word introduction “Right now, I know, two hearts, never be the same, / Right now, I know, talking bout the party people, / Talking bout the party people.” It’s clearly a continuation of Georgia’s celebration of club culture that we heard through ‘About Work The Dancefloor’, as well as her undeniable love for rhythm, whether that’s the skillful percussion in her music or the natural beat of our hearts. Through the dance and pop fuelled momentum of ‘24 Hours’, Georgia maps out the very thing that connects us all - rhythm. - Hannah Thacker
